Summary: | The invention discloses a gear assembly with optimized configuration of meshing rigidity. The gear assembly includes a first gear having a first hub surrounded by a first plurality of teeth. Each of the first plurality of teeth defines a respective first contact area. The gear assembly includes a second gear having a second hub surrounded by a second plurality of teeth. The second plurality of teeth is adapted to engage the first plurality of teeth at a respective first contact area to drive a respective load in a first direction. The first hub and the first plurality of teeth include respective regions defining respective elastic moduli. A three-dimensional distribution of the respective physical size and the respective elastic modulus of the respective region is optimized such that a fluctuation in meshing stiffness along the respective first contact region is at or below a first predetermined threshold.
